The interior space of Metro Mall at Chatuchak MRT Station undergoes a comprehensive redesign, revitalizing corridors, shops, and common areas. The objective is to achieve a modern, spacious, and well-organized ambiance. The redesign also introduces a communal area thoughtfully proportioned for users to comfortably sit and relax.
A key focal point of this endeavor lies in the diverse array of shops, each boasting its own unique variety and colors. The predominant color palette is a sleek combination of black and white, accentuated by crisp white lighting. Notably, distinct black and white line graphics, meticulously crafted, incorporate a range of elements inspired by Chatuchak Park – from fence patterns to flowers, food, market scenes, and even the characteristic of scorching hot weather of Thailand. These elements come together to create a lively and vibrant atmosphere, infusing the electric train area with a refreshing sense of novelty.
